In the room settings all aids were switched to NO
It's slightly more complicated than that.

And it depends on what you have the driving assists set to in the game's Authenticity menu. If it's set to authentic even though the room will say NO you will still have the option to use the various aids IF the real world counterpart also makes use of them. And since I believe it defaults to low ABS and TC you may have been using them without realising it. The levels can be adjusted or switched off completely if you have the buttons mapped.

If you have the driving assists set to off or full in the options menu you wouldn't be able to use them either way in the race - because they are either off from your choice or because Sick has them disabled.

I have mine set to authentic so I can choose to use them or not. Which I recommend is the most realistic option and it keeps it more even between the players.


Strangely the "Force Realistic Driving Aids" in the online race setup screens doesn't seem to actually do what you'd think it should - enable the aids where they should be. In fact it doesn't seem to do much at all! I was going to suggest it to Sick otherwise.

Are you saying I can copy a replay from the game directly to a USB drive?
Well yes and no. You can copy a replay onto a drive but then you would need to transfer it to another PS4 with PC2 on it to watch it. It's not a video file in other words.
